Absorption is when a wave's energy is taken in by a medium. Diffraction is the bending of waves around obstacles or through openings. Reflection is when a wave bounces back from a surface. Refraction is the bending of a wave as it passes from one medium to another with a different optical density, which is shown in the image where the wave changes direction when moving from Medium 1 to Medium 2.
